Within the 120-semester-hour program, students must complete a minimum of 27 hours of upper-level Information Assurance and Cybersecurity Management (IACM) coursework with a grade of C- in all courses, except ISM 3011, for which a minimum grade of C must be earned. All students entering USF for the first time in Fall 2017 or later, who subsequently earn three (3) D and/or F grades in any or any combination of the following courses at USF will be required to change their major to a major more appropriate to their goals and academic performance and to a major not conferred by the Muma College of Business. Topics such as network security, database management, risk management, security policies, forensics, and security protocols are covered as they relate to managing the availability, integrity, authentication, confidentiality, and non-repudiation of the information infrastructure as well as its restoration, integrating protection, detection, and reaction capabilities. <>
